Types of eVisa Indonesia: What Type of Visa should you select

It is necessary to know the various Indonesian eVisa types before applying. Finding the correct one makes you not get stuck with limitations or be prohibited. Here’s a quick breakdown:

  • Tourist / Visitor eVisa: Perfect in short term travelers who come to have a holiday, sightseeing or pay visits. Typically 30-day and can be renewed based on the type.
  • eVisa on Arrival (e-VOA): This is an electronic pre applied variant of the usual visa-on-arrival. It is user friendly as it saves on time spent at airports. It also allows 30 days of stay.
  • Social, Cultural or Business eVisa: In handy when you are attending conferences, cultural events and when you are staying over and stay longer than 30 days. There are versions that can provide a 60-day accommodation with extension.
  • Several Entry visas or Long stay Visa: Less frequently offered to casual travelers, but offered to visitors who came often or were staying long-term, either to work, study or retire.

Majority of the Azerbaijan travelers going there as a tourist will use the Tourist eVisa or eVisa on Arrival.

Step-by-Step: Indonesia eVisa Application Process from Azerbaijan

We shall divide the entire Indonesia eVisa application process into the agents applying in Azerbaijan.

Step 1: Prepare Your Documents: 

You will need the following before you begin:

  • An authentic passport that has a validity of 6 months and above.
  • Recent photograph (digital) of passport size.
  • Photocopy of the ID page of your passport
  • An outbound or a return air ticket.
  • Evidence of a place (hotel reservation or address).
  • A working email address

With everything prepared, it will be easy to get through the application.

Step 2. Enroll with the Internet Portal: 

Register on the visa application system. You will be required to enter your complete name, e-mail and a password. Check your account by email further.

Step 3: Complete Application Form:

You are required to fill your personal information as it is contained in the passport. This includes your:

  • Full name
  • Date of birth
  • Passport number and date of expiry.
  • Nationality
  • Arrival and departure dates
  • Purpose of visit
  • Indonesia accommodation address.

Take your time here. The fact that you made a simple typo may make your visa postponed or even denied.

Step 4: Submit Your Supportive Documentation:

You’ll be prompted to upload:

  • Your passport scan
  • A passport-style photo
  • Flight booking
  • Hotel confirmation

Ensure that all files are clear, legible and in proper format. Review every upload before sending.

Step 5: Pay the Visa Fee Online: 

And when it is all filled out, pay. Use the card that is capable of executing international transactions. There are banks that may prevent international transactions, and in such a case, you will have to allow international transactions before making a purchase.

Hint: The card is not always supposed to be in your name, but it should be valid.

Step 6: Wait for Processing: 

Your application is reviewed after it has been submitted. The duration of processing is changeable based on the kind of eVisa and demand. Most of the eVisas that are granted to tourists take 1-5 working days.

Make sure that you have checked your email (including your spam mail) to get notifications.

Step 7: Print and Store Your eVisa: 

Upon approval you will be provided with a downloadable eVisa document. Insert it into your phone and make a hard copy. Carry it along with passport on your trip.
